Welcome, plugin authors. Before your extension can request credentials from Rotarium, our internal secrets-rotation utility, you must complete the sandbox enrollment steps. Install the Rotarium plugin SDK, register your plugin manifest, and run the conformance suite twice — once against the staging rotator and once against the replay harness. If your plugin ever loses its enrollment state (for example after a sandbox wipe), you can restore it using the shared recovery flow. For sandbox tenants only, the recovery passphrase is listed below.

vault phrase of bafop-yajef = briiel-briiel-wenax-novael

## Deploying the Gatewick Proctor Queue

Deploys are pretty painless: push to main, wait for the pipeline, then watch the queue drain dashboard for five minutes. If candidates pile up mid-exam, roll back first and ask questions later — the queue replays safely. Everything the workers care about lives in one config block, shown here for reference.

settings of bafof-yagef:
JOROX_PIN=8740
JOROX_TENANT=pelox
JOROX_METRICS_HOST=metrics.jorox.qorvelworks.internal
JOROX_SEAL=seal_c78f63c1
JOROX_STANDBY_TEAM=norax

## Changelog — Quillrate v3.2

Changed default rounding mode from truncate to banker's rounding in currency conversion. Truncation caused cumulative drift in multi-leg conversions, flagged by the Lurgan finance team. All new deployments pick this up automatically; existing ones need a restart. The current defaults for the conversion service are listed below.

deployment values, yadug-bawif:
[framir]
team = pelox
access_code = ac_a38ab2
owner = tamion.julael
host = framir.tolvaqlabs.test
port = 11211
peer = tammir.zemvargrid.local
salt = 2215ef03
pin = 1541

## Alert: StatRelay Sidecar Flush Lag

This alert fires when the StatRelay metrics-aggregation sidecar falls more than 120 seconds behind on flushing buffered samples to the Coalmine backend. Plugin-emitted counters are buffered in-process, so sustained lag usually means a plugin is emitting unbounded label cardinality or blocking the flush thread. Check your plugin's metric registration against the published cardinality limits before escalating. If the lag persists after your plugin is ruled out, contact the telemetry team.

escalation mailbox, bagug-fahof: novdor.wendor.jormir@norvalabs.example